The routine starts in a tabletop position, where Dean leads participants through a cat-cow series to promote spinal mobility. He instructs individuals to ensure their hands are under their shoulders and knees under their hips, maintaining a neutral spine.
Cat-Cow Sequence
Participants take deep breaths while arching their backs during inhalation (creating a cow pose) and rounding their backs while exhaling (entering a cat pose). Dean advises to match the duration of breaths and emphasizes the importance of maintaining space in the neck throughout the movements.
